SlackAdapter.ProcessAsync 方法

定义

接受传入的 Webhook 请求,并将其转换为可由机器人逻辑处理的 TurnContext。

public System.Threading.Tasks.Task ProcessAsync(Microsoft.AspNetCore.Http.HttpRequest request, Microsoft.AspNetCore.Http.HttpResponse response, Microsoft.Bot.Builder.IBot bot, System.Threading.CancellationToken cancellationToken);
abstract member ProcessAsync : Microsoft.AspNetCore.Http.HttpRequest * Microsoft.AspNetCore.Http.HttpResponse * Microsoft.Bot.Builder.IBot * System.Threading.CancellationToken -> System.Threading.Tasks.Task
override this.ProcessAsync : Microsoft.AspNetCore.Http.HttpRequest * Microsoft.AspNetCore.Http.HttpResponse * Microsoft.Bot.Builder.IBot *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Function ProcessAsync (request As HttpRequest, response As HttpResponse, bot As IBot, cancellationToken As CancellationToken) As Task

参数

request
HttpRequest

传入的 HTTP 请求。

response
HttpResponse

此方法完成后,要发送的 HTTP 响应。

bot
IBot

将处理传入活动的机器人。

cancellationToken
CancellationToken

任务的取消标记。

返回

表示异步操作的 Task

实现

适用于